Broward College Signs Orlando Tennis Player Addison Barnette

Posted on: 2/7/2013 1:01 PM
Addison Barnette, who played No. 5 singles and No. 2 doubles on Orlando Freedom High’s Central Florida powerhouse tennis team last season, will compete for Broward College’s women’s tennis team next year. Barnette signed with Broward at National Signing Day ceremonies at her school.

AddisonBarnette.jpgA righty who started playing tennis at age 5 and never wanted to take up any other sport, Barnette plans to study secondary education at Broward. She should make an immediate impact for the Seahawks, who finished in fifth place at NJCAA nationals in 2012.​
